
Shefali Jariwala Death: Shehnaaz Gill, Paras Chhabra, Sunidhi Chauhan And Others Attend Last Rites
New Delhi:
Actor and model Shefali Jariwala died late Friday, and her last rites were performed in Mumbai on Saturday evening, with close family members and friends in attendance.
What's Happening
Following the news of Shefali Jariwala's death, her Bigg Boss 13 co-contestants Mahira Sharma, Arti Singh, Paras Chhabra and Rashami Desai visited the crematorium to offer condolences to the family.
Actor Shehnaaz Gill, who also appeared with Shefali on Bigg Boss 13, was present at the cremation.
Mika Singh also attended the last rites of the actress.
Background
Shefali Jariwala reportedly suffered a cardiac arrest at her Mumbai residence late Friday. Parag Tyagi rushed her to the hospital, where doctors declared her dead on arrival.
Visuals from outside the hospital showed Parag in tears. The family has not released an official statement yet.
Shefali first rose to fame with the 2002 music video Kaanta Laga, which became a massive hit. She later appeared in the film Mujhse Shaadi Karogi, alongside Akshay Kumar and Salman Khan.
In later years, she transitioned to television, participating in the dance reality show Nach Baliye with her husband Parag Tyagi, and later entering the Bigg Boss 13 house.
Her entry into Bigg Boss drew attention, particularly due to her past relationship with fellow contestant and late actor Sidharth Shukla. The two had dated over a decade ago.

Who Is Parag Tyagi? All About Shefali Jariwala's Second Husband
As Shefali Jariwala passed away unexpectedly, her husband Parag Tyagi was found in a heartbroken condition outside the hospital. Shefali Jariwala, who rose to fame with her stint in the music video Kaanta Laga, unexpectedly left for the heavenly abode on June 27. The 42-year-old actress suffered a cardiac arrest and died in Mumbai. Although she was rushed to the Bellevue Multispeciality hospital in Andheri by her husband Parag Tyagi, she was declared dead on arrival. Let's look back at her heartbroken spouse's personal and professional life. Several videos of Parag Tyagi have surfaced on the internet, where he could be found completely heartbroken over the passing of his ladylove, Shefali Jariwala. The lovebirds were counted among one of the most adorable couples in the industry, who kept painting the town red with their mushy moments on social media platforms and during public appearances. In a recent video on Instagram, the doting husband can be seen visibly upset as he drove out of the hospital. Who Is Parag Tyagi? Parag Tyagi, hailing from Modinagar, made his acting debut in 2008 with the crime thriller, A Wednesday! starring Naseeruddin Shah and Anupam Kher in the lead. Next year, the actor made his television debut as Vinod Karanjkar in Zee TV's Pavitra Rishta. Following this, he went on to appear in several films and TV shows, including Brahmarakshas, Jodha Akbar and Shakti Astitva Ke Ehsaas Ki, among many others. The actor has also worked in Telugu films, including Agnyaathavaasi, Venky Mama, Ruler and Sarkaru Vaari Paata. Lastly, he was seen in the Salman Khan-starrer movie Kisi Ka Bhai Kisi Ki Jaan, which was released in 2023. He appeared in the role of Yogeshwar Kodati in the action comedy film. View this post on Instagram A post shared by Parag Tyagi (@paragtyagi) Parag Tyagi's Personal Life The 49-year-old was married to late actress Shefali Jariwala, but this was her second marriage. Previously, the diva tied the knot to musician Harmeet Singh from Meet Brothers in 2004. After 5 years of marriage, the actress pressed charges against Harmeet, claiming domestic violence and a lack of emotional respect in the relationship. She also mentioned experiencing mental distress in her marriage. Following this, the couple got divorced in 2009. Later, she started dating actor Parag Tyagi. After being in a relationship for four years, the couple got hitched in 2015. Since then, they continued serving couple goals with their camaraderie. They also participated in Nach Baliye 5 and Nach Baliye 7, but ultimately finished in 7th place.
